Background PT GMT Indonesia (GMT) is a full services geological and mining consulting group, exploration / project development and project management company, domiciled in Jakarta at Talavera Suite 18th Floor, Talavera Office Park, Jl TB Simatupang Kav. 22-26’ Cilandak Barat, Jakarta 12430 and with an operations office at Jl. H. Mandior No 23, Cilandak Barat, 12430, Jakarta Selatan, Indonesia. GMT services domestic and international mining and exploration companies from its base in Indonesia.

GMT was founded in 2001 by its’ President Director, Brett D. Gunter, an Australian geologist, long-term resident in Indonesia, together with his Indonesian partner Krisjna Alimoeddin, Vice-President of the company. From the outset, they dedicated themselves to offering the highest level of geological expertise and exploration capability to Indonesia’s mineral exploration sector.

From its’ inception, the founders of GMT sought to create a unique synergy between the best of Indonesia’s diverse pool of geological talent and an innovative, yet down-to-earth Australian perspective - coupled with the consistency and “no-compromise” management discipline necessary to maintain the highest level of professional and ethical standards.

Importantly, GMT senior personnel are qualified to be classified as Competent Persons/Qualified Persons under international systems of reporting of mineral resources and mining reserves, such as the JORC Code (2004) and NI 43-101 reporting systems.

GMT Services GMT manages a wide range of exploration, development and mining disciplines.

• Project generation and regional evaluations, structural analysis and remote sensing

interpretations, construction and analysis of GIS (geographic information systems), design

of exploration programs and exploration project management.

• Data compilations, reviews and desktop studies, evaluations of QA/QC programs, advice

on exploration project implementation, target ranking, ancillary requirements of exploration

programs, statutory investigations, community liaison guidance.

• Program design for exploration drilling, Resource definition drilling and development

drilling.

• Resource and reserve estimations, scoping studies and feasibility studies, financial

analysis and marketing studies, mine design and production scheduling. Infrastructure

design and layout, process design in conjunction with professional metallurgists and design

engineers. Compilation of financial models to determine valuations. Mineral property

valuations in accordance with the Valmin Code.

Major Skills Exploration Rapid, remote reconnaissance prospecting; design and implementation of regional

green-fields programmes to identify follow-up targets; target definition and project generation utilising a mixture of remote sensing, geological observation and geochemical evaluation; design and implementation of prospect based geological, geochemical and geophysical programmes; drill target definition; exploration and resource based drilling utilising diamond and reverse circulation methods; target prioritisation; exploration budgeting and financial control; assistance, coordination and implementation of feasibility studies.

Page 9: Exploration and mining advice to the Indonesian mining · PDF fileExploration and mining advice to the Indonesian mining industry Operational Office Jalan H. Mandor No 23, Cilandak

Page 2

Geological An understanding of the mechanics of mineral formation; particular skills in hydrothermal ore deposits such as epithermal, porphyry and skarn styles of mineralisation; structural control on ore formation; mineralisation vectoring through alteration zoning and geochemical signatures; mineralisation in deeply weathered terrains; tectonic terranes and the relationship to mineralisation styles; modes of mineralisation occurrence; regional metallogenic concepts. Good foundation in sedimentary geology and basin development with respect to sedimentary deposits, erosional residues and secondary enrichment.
